3/31/2023 0 Comments Mineos ssh shellInstall-Module -Name WinSCP Get-Command -Module WinSCP CommandType Name Version SourceĪlias Close-WinSCPSession 5.17.10.0 WinSCPĪlias Enter-WinSCPSession 5.17.10.0 WinSCPĪlias Exit-WinSCPSession 5.17.10.0 WinSCPĪlias Open-WinSCPSession 5.17.10.0 WinSCPįunction ConvertTo-WinSCPEscapedString 5.17.10.0 WinSCPįunction Copy-WinSCPItem 5.17.10.0 WinSCPįunction Get-WinSCPChildItem 5.17.10.0 WinSCPįunction Get-WinSCPHostKeyFingerprint 5.17.10.0 WinSCPįunction Get-WinSCPItemChecksum 5.17.10.0 WinSCPįunction Get-WinSCPSession 5.17.10.0 WinSCPįunction Invoke-WinSCPCommand 5.17.10.0 WinSCPįunction Move-WinSCPItem 5.17.10.0 WinSCPįunction New-WinSCPItemPermission 5.17.10.0 WinSCPįunction New-WinSCPSession 5.17.10.0 WinSCPįunction New-WinSCPSessionOption 5.17.10.0 WinSCPįunction New-WinSCPTransferOption 5.17.10.0 WinSCPįunction New-WinSCPTransferResumeSupport 5.17.10.0 WinSCPįunction Receive-WinSCPItem 5.17.10.0 WinSCPįunction Remove-WinSCPItem 5.17.10.0 WinSCPįunction Remove-WinSCPSession 5.17.10.0 WinSCPįunction Rename-WinSCPItem 5.17.10.0 WinSCPįunction Send-WinSCPItem 5.17.10.0 WinSCPįunction Start-WinSCPConsole 5.17.10.0 WinSCPįunction Sync-WinSCPPath 5.17.10.0 WinSCPįunction Test-WinSCPPath 5.17.10.0 WinSCP # Set credentials to a PSCredential Object. In most cases, all you need to do is download the WinSCP-X.X.X-Automation.zip package and extract it along with your PowerShell script. Set-SFTPFile -SessionId 0 -LocalFile c:\temp\TestIII.txt -RemotePath /SFTP/tom -Overwrite:$trueįirst, you need to install the WinSCP. Write-Host "Upload file to SFTP server" -ForegroundColor Green Get-SFTPFile -SessionId 0 -RemoteFile /SFTP/tom/Test.txt -LocalPath c:\temp # Upload file to SFTP server Write-Host "Download file to client" -ForegroundColor Green Get-SFTPChildItem -SessionId 0 -Path "/SFTP/tom/" # Download file to client Write-Host "Listing files." -ForegroundColor Green New-SFTPItem -SessionId 0 -Path "/SFTP/tom/test2.txt" -ItemType file # List subdirectory files on SFTP server Write-Host "Creating file." -ForegroundColor Green New-SFTPSession -Computername 127.0.0.1 C:\SFTP\tom # Creating a txt file on SFTP server Write-Host "Connecting." -ForegroundColor Green Get-Command -Module Posh-SSH CommandType Name Version Sourceįunction Get-PoshSSHModVersion 2.3.0 Posh-SSHįunction Get-SFTPChildItem 2.3.0 Posh-SSHįunction Get-SFTPPathAttribute 2.3.0 Posh-SSHįunction Get-SSHPortForward 2.3.0 Posh-SSHįunction Get-SSHTrustedHost 2.3.0 Posh-SSHįunction Invoke-SSHCommand 2.3.0 Posh-SSHįunction Invoke-SSHCommandStream 2.3.0 Posh-SSHįunction Invoke-SSHStreamExpectAction 2.3.0 Posh-SSHįunction Invoke-SSHStreamExpectSecureAction 2.3.0 Posh-SSHįunction Invoke-SSHStreamShellCommand 2.3.0 Posh-SSHįunction New-SFTPFileStream 2.3.0 Posh-SSHįunction New-SSHDynamicPortForward 2.3.0 Posh-SSHįunction New-SSHLocalPortForward 2.3.0 Posh-SSHįunction New-SSHRemotePortForward 2.3.0 Posh-SSHįunction New-SSHShellStream 2.3.0 Posh-SSHįunction New-SSHTrustedHost 2.3.0 Posh-SSHįunction Remove-SFTPSession 2.3.0 Posh-SSHįunction Remove-SSHSession 2.3.0 Posh-SSHįunction Remove-SSHTrustedHost 2.3.0 Posh-SSHįunction Set-SFTPPathAttribute 2.3.0 Posh-SSHįunction Start-SSHPortForward 2.3.0 Posh-SSHįunction Stop-SSHPortForward 2.3.0 Posh-SSHĬmdlet Set-SFTPItem 2.3.0 Posh-SSH # Connecting to the SFTP - Server Write-Host "Listing all Posh-SSH - Commands." -ForegroundColor Green Install-module posh-ssh # Show all available module commands Write-Host "Installing the Posh-SSH Module" -ForegroundColor Green Posh-SSH Module: # Installing Posh Module However, it may already contain helpful information and therefore it has been published at this stage.
0 Comments
Leave a Reply. |
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|